13 Facts About Penny Ford

facts about penny ford.html1.

Penny Ford rose to fame in the 1980s after signing a recording contract with Total Experience Records and releasing her debut solo album, Pennye.

2.

Penny Ford has been a member of the groups Klymaxx and Soul II Soul.

3.

Penny Ford was born in Cincinnati, Ohio, to Carolyn Griffith, an evangelist, and Gene Redd, Sr.

4.

Penny Ford attended St Mark Catholic School in Cincinnati, where she enrolled in dance and music classes.

5.

In 1986, Penny Ford replaced Lorena Shelby as the lead singer of Klymaxx.

6.

In 1988, Penny Ford became friends with fellow vocalist Chaka Khan while singing background vocals on "Our Day Will Come", a duet with Edwin Starr.

7.

Penny Ford toured as a background vocalist for Khan's European Tour in 1988.

8.

9.

In 1994, Penny Ford began working with Soul II Soul again.

10.

Penny Ford sang lead vocals on their single "Love Enuff", which was released in 1995.

11.

Penny Ford was present when the group performed the song on Top of the Pops.

12.

In 2022, Penny Ford was inducted into the Cincinnati Black Music Walk of Fame.

13.

Penny Ford has been known to play the guitar, flute, drums, percussion, bass, keyboards, and synthesizer, all of which she played during her early career as a demo singer.
